BTGmoderatorDC wrote:If the average of 993, 994, 996, 997, 998, 1001, 1001, 1002, 1004 and x is 999, what is the value of x?
A. 999
B. 1001
C. 1003
D. 1004
E. 1005
Sum of the 10 terms = (quantity)(average) = 10*999 = 9990.
If we add the units digits of the nine given terms, we get:
3+4+6+7+8+1+1+2+4 = 36.
The sum of the nine given terms has a units digit of 6.
The sum of all ten terms has a units digit of 0.
Since (units digit of 6) + (units digit of 4) = (units digit of 0), x must have a units digit of 4.
The correct answer is
D.
